Do512 Family Park Spotlight: Mayfield Preserve
Looking for a short hike your kids can handle? Check out Mayfield Park and Preserve. Mayfield often tops the lists of best parks in Austin with its picturesque gardens and exotic peacocks. But behind the gardens are short hiking trails perfect for exploring with small children. Here, we've given you a step-by-step guide to the trail so you can meander through the woods with your kids and know what to look for and expect.

Old Settler’s Music Festival
It's time once again for the annual Old Settler's Music Festival, going down from Thursday, Apr. 10 - Sunday, Apr. 13 at Salt Lick pavilion and Camp Ben McCulloch. This festival has been going strong since 1987, and has maintained its down-home, friendly, Texas vibe. You'll hear lots of music, eat awesome food, attend workshops, camp, let the kids play in the youth area and kick back with plenty of cold beers (if you want).
